Technical Field
[0001] This utility model relates to the technical field of metal parts inspection equipment, specifically to an automatic bolt defect screening device. Background Technology
[0002] In modern industrial production, bolts are widely used fasteners, and their quality directly affects the safe and stable operation of various mechanical equipment. Therefore, after bolt production, rigorous defect inspection must be carried out to ensure that bolts put into use meet quality standards. Currently, optical inspection methods, with their advantages of high precision and high efficiency, are widely used in the field of bolt defect inspection.
[0003] However, existing optical inspection equipment typically requires multiple cameras to photograph bolts from different angles to achieve omnidirectional inspection, thus increasing the cost of the equipment. To address this issue, Chinese Patent Publication No. CN114264250A provides a bolt thread inspection device, which includes a worktable, a conveyor turntable, and a control unit. Several support frames are evenly fixed to the side wall of the conveyor turntable, and each support frame is rotatably connected to a limit ring. The upper end of the limit ring has a limiting groove for the bolt head to engage. By using a driving component to drive the limit ring, the bolt rotates 360°. When the bolt passes the screw camera, the screw camera can photograph the bolt. This design only requires one screw camera to achieve omnidirectional imaging of the thread, thereby reducing the cost of the inspection equipment.
[0004] While the aforementioned existing technology can achieve omnidirectional imaging of threads, it still has the following technical problems: during use, the bolt head is clamped by the limiting groove on the limiting ring. However, bolt heads come in various types, while the limiting groove can only be used for a specific type, resulting in a limited range of applicable types. Furthermore, if multiple types of bolts are to be accommodated, the limiting ring needs to be replaced before each use. However, in the existing technology, the limiting ring is fixedly sleeved with the drive gear ring, making it very inconvenient to disassemble and replace. Utility Model Content
[0005] This utility model provides an automatic bolt defect screening device, which can solve the technical problem of the limited applicability of the limiting fixing ring in the prior art.
[0006] This application provides the following technical solution:
[0007] An automatic bolt defect screening device includes a worktable and a screening disc rotatably positioned at the center of the worktable. The worktable also includes a feeding station, a photographing station, and a unloading station arranged circumferentially around the screening disc. The screening disc is further equipped with multiple rotation limiting mechanisms arranged in an array around its center. Each rotation limiting mechanism includes a turntable, a driving component, and telescopic clamping components mounted on the turntable. The screening disc has several installation channels, and the turntable is rotatably positioned within these channels via the driving component. The surface of the turntable is flush with the surface of the screening disc. The center of the turntable is a bolt placement area, and the telescopic clamping components are symmetrically positioned on both sides of the placement area to clamp and limit the bolt heads in the placement area.
[0008] Beneficial effects:
[0009] 1. By symmetrically arranging the telescopic clamping components on both sides of the bolt placement area, the telescopic adjustment can be made according to the size or type of the bolt head, accommodating various types of bolts. This effectively solves the problem of the limited applicability of existing limit grooves, improving the versatility and applicability of the equipment. Furthermore, using the telescopic clamping components to hold and fix the bolts ensures their stability, preventing displacement or tilting of the bolts as they rotate with the screening disc and turntable.
[0010] 2. Because different workstations are arranged in an orderly manner on the workbench, when the bolt rotates with the screening disc to the shooting position, the drive component drives the turntable to rotate 360°, thereby causing the bolt to rotate one revolution at the shooting position. This achieves the purpose of shooting the thread from all directions through a single camera device, reducing the cost of use. Moreover, during the shooting inspection, the bolt is fixed by the telescopic clamping component, which avoids shaking when the bolt rotates, improves the accuracy of the shooting, ensures the precision of the screening, and reduces the possibility of misjudgment.
[0011] Furthermore, a mounting bracket is provided at the bottom of the screening disc, and the drive component is mounted on the mounting bracket. The power output end of the drive component is fixedly connected to the turntable, and the drive component is used to drive the turntable to rotate 360°.
[0012] Beneficial effects: By placing the drive unit on the mounting bracket at the bottom of the screening plate, the space under the equipment is fully utilized, making the overall structure more compact and reasonable; this layout avoids the need to set up additional drive units around the screening plate or in other locations, reducing the equipment's footprint.
[0013] Furthermore, the telescopic clamping assembly includes a cylinder and a clamping block. The clamping block is fixedly connected to the piston rod of the cylinder, and the cylinder drives the clamping block to clamp both sides of the bolt head.
[0014] Beneficial effects: Once the bolt is placed in the bolt placement area of the turntable, the cylinder can quickly drive the clamping block to extend and clamp the bolt head, reducing the processing time for a single bolt and thus improving the overall efficiency of the screening equipment, meeting the rapid screening needs of large-scale production. Furthermore, the output force of the cylinder can be adjusted by regulating the air pressure, allowing for flexible adjustment of the clamping force on the bolt head according to different types and materials of bolts.
[0015] Furthermore, the turntable is also equipped with a lifting platform, which includes a telescopic component and a platform. The turntable has an installation slot, the telescopic component is installed in the installation slot, and the platform is slidably installed in the installation slot. The platform is driven to move up and down in the installation slot by the telescopic component.
[0016] Furthermore, bolts or telescopic clamping components are installed on the lifting platform.
[0017] Beneficial effects: When the bolt is placed on the lifting platform, the telescopic clamping assembly retracts at the unloading station. At this time, the lifting platform lifts the bolt upward, making it easier to push the bolt into the unloading hopper and reducing interference from the telescopic clamping assembly. If the telescopic clamping assembly is placed on the lifting platform, when the bolt is transported to the unloading station, the lifting platform moves the telescopic clamping assembly downward into the installation slot, avoiding interference with the bolt unloading.
[0018] Furthermore, the feeding station is equipped with a feeding channel, the feeding end of which is connected to a feeding vibratory feeder, and the discharge port of the feeding channel is aligned with the placement area of the turntable.
[0019] Furthermore, the shooting station is equipped with a mounting base and an industrial camera, which is electrically connected to a controller.
[0020] Furthermore, the unloading station includes a good product unloading station and a defective product unloading station. The unloading station is equipped with an unloading assembly, which includes a hopper, a material pipe, and an air nozzle. The inlet of the hopper is close to the outer circumference of the screening disc, and the outlet of the hopper is connected to the material pipe. The air nozzle is installed on the hopper through an adjustment assembly and faces the inlet of the hopper, and is used to blow the bolts into the hopper.
[0021] Beneficial effects: Traditional contact unloading methods, such as robotic arm gripping or pusher pushing, may cause friction and collision with the bolt surface, resulting in scratches, wear and other damage to the bolt surface; while the air nozzle uses non-contact unloading, using airflow to blow the bolt into the hopper, avoiding direct contact with the bolt, and effectively protecting the integrity of the bolt surface. For bolts with high surface quality requirements, such as bolts used in high-precision instruments or products with strict appearance requirements, this method can ensure that their surface quality is not affected by the unloading process.
[0022] Furthermore, the adjustment component includes an L-shaped bracket, on which several adjustment holes are provided on both the horizontal and vertical sides. The horizontal side of the L-shaped bracket is fixed to the hopper by fasteners, and the air nozzle is fixed to the adjustment hole on the vertical side of the L-shaped bracket. The air nozzle is connected to a compressed air device through a pipe.
[0023] Beneficial effects: By setting up an L-shaped bracket and adjustment holes, it is easy to flexibly adjust the horizontal position and vertical height of the air nozzle according to the model or type of bolt, so as to ensure the unloading effect of the airflow.
[0024] Furthermore, protective pads are installed on the inner walls of both the hopper and the feed pipe.
[0025] Beneficial effect: The protective pads protect the bolts during unloading, preventing them from impacting the inner wall when they fall. Attached Figure Description

[0040] In use, the bolt 100 to be tested is poured into the vibratory feeder, which transports the bolt 100 to the feeding channel 4. Then, it falls from the feeding channel 4 to the placement area of the turntable 31 of the screening tray 2. By activating the cylinder 332, the piston rod of the cylinder 332 extends and drives the clamping block 331 to clamp and fix the bolt head. Subsequently, the bolt 100 is transported by the screening tray 2 to the shooting station 12. At this station, the motor drives the turntable 31 to rotate, thereby causing the bolt 100 to rotate 360°, so that the industrial camera 52 can take pictures of the screw from all directions. Then, the bolt 100 is continued to be transported to the unloading station. If the screw is qualified, the air nozzle 73 on the good product unloading station 14 is activated. The air nozzle 73 sprays air to blow the bolt 100 into the hopper 71 and discharges it from the material pipe 72 along the hopper 71. If the screw is defective, the air nozzle 73 on the defective product unloading station 13 is activated to unload the defective product.
